What are the key challenges in designing arcade machines for universal accessibility?

Designing arcade machines for universal accessibility presents several key challenges. First, physical accessibility is critical, as machines must accommodate players with mobility impairments, requiring adjustable heights, wheelchair-friendly designs, and easy-to-reach controls. Second, visual and auditory accessibility demands high-contrast displays, customizable sound options, and tactile feedback for visually or hearing-impaired players. Third, cognitive accessibility involves simplifying game mechanics and providing clear instructions to support players with learning disabilities. Additionally, cost and space constraints often limit the feasibility of implementing these features. Finally, balancing inclusivity with the fast-paced, competitive nature of arcade gaming remains a significant challenge. Addressing these issues ensures that arcade machines can be enjoyed by everyone, regardless of ability.
